Adds a nightly reindex job for Lanternquery. Runs under the existing `indexer` service account; no new permissions. Reads from the replica only, writes to a staging index, then atomically swaps aliases. Failures page on-call and leave the old index live. No PII leaves the cluster. Security-relevant limits and timeouts are pinned in config as follows:

tuning table, faweg-bajep:
WEIGHTS = {
    "belius": 690,
    "eliox": 458,
    "norax": 616,
    "praion": 132,
    "zorvan": 911,
}

CI note for security review: the Lanternmere schema registry job fails when compatibility checks run against unsigned event schemas. The pipeline now rejects any schema artifact lacking a verified publisher signature, and the validation step logs which subject failed. No secrets are exposed in these logs; payload samples are redacted at source. To reproduce the failure locally, pull the registry image referenced by the token immediately following this note.

session token of tajef-bageg = htk21_5d90d574934f3ccae6437

This alert fires when more than 30% of backend nodes registered with the Gatewick load balancer fail two consecutive health probes. Plugin authors should note that custom readiness endpoints must respond within 1500 ms, or Gatewick marks the node as draining and reroutes traffic to surviving peers. Repeated flapping may indicate a misconfigured probe path in your plugin manifest rather than genuine node failure. Full probe semantics, retry budgets, and de-registration rules are documented on our internal reference page.

operations page: https://jenkins.zemvarcloud.local/job/merge_requests/repo/build/73930b4b30f0a8ed